Abstract
In today's rapidly evolving healthcare sector, the integration of new technologies and innovations brings increased risks related to medical data security, privacy, and data loss prevention. Blockchain, recognized as one of the most advanced technologies, offers robust protection for data integrity, availability, and confidentiality against various cyber threats. Through the implementation of smart contracts—programmable, self-executing protocols on the blockchain—a secure framework is developed to enhance data protection, safeguard patient privacy, ensure traceability, and provide patients with full control over their health records. The data-sharing mechanisms incorporated into Arogyam and other systems benefit from increased trust and traceability, making healthcare data management more secure and transparent.
